Granite tile repair services involve restoring the appearance and functionality of existing granite tiles that have become damaged or worn over time. This process typically includes fixing cracked, chipped, or loose tiles, as well as addressing issues like uneven surfaces or grout deterioration.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to carefully remove damaged sections, repair or replace tiles as needed, and restore the surface to look seamless and durable. Proper repair can help extend the life of granite surfaces, maintaining their natural beauty and ensuring they remain safe and functional for everyday use.
Many property owners turn to granite tile repair to resolve common problems such as cracks that develop from impacts, chips caused by heavy objects, or loose tiles that pose tripping hazards. Over time, grout lines may become discolored or crumble, leading to unsightly gaps and potential water damage. Repair services can also address issues like staining or surface scratches that diminish the visual appeal of granite. By fixing these problems promptly, homeowners can prevent further damage and avoid the need for more costly replacements, keeping their spaces looking polished and well-maintained.

The overview below groups typical Granite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Granger,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or granite tile rep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as chip or crack repairs,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Restoration - Restoring larger sections or replacing damaged tiles usually costs between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ve multiple tiles or surface refinishing, which local contractors handle regularly within this range.
Full Replacement - Complete granite tile replacement can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more depending on the size of the area and material quality. Larger, more complex projects can reach beyond this range, but many jobs stay within the mid to upper tiers.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om cuts, intricate patterns, or extensive repairs may cost $5,000+ in some cases. Such projects are less common and typically involve detailed work requiring specialized skills from local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
